HELP PLEASE!!! Sputtering issues on '98 GSR
A few things to note first:
1.) Ignitor and coil pack have been replaced
2.) O2 sensor on the exhaust pipe is now currently unplugged
3.) Map sensor has been checked ok
4.) Compression outstanding
5.) Plugs and wires fine
It started and drove fine for a 5 minute test run. Shut it down and cranked it an hour later to take a ride again and as soon as I flutter the gas to back out it bogs down. Car has never left me on the side of the road, EVER, and still has not. It sometimes bogs to the point where the tack seems to be at zero and you wonder how it's still running but it is. When I left work one day i chanced it and drove it home when I got it between 2-3 thousand RPMs it seemed ok still slight sputter but driveable. I'm just lost on this. I can only suspect foul gas.
